Chiseled Design: Aesthetic Excellence Meets Aerodynamic Efficiency

Chiseled Design: Aesthetic Excellence Meets Aerodynamic Efficiency

The most striking feature of the refreshed Tesla Model 3 is its chiseled design, which seamlessly blends aesthetic excellence with aerodynamic efficiency. Tesla has taken a page from the book of minimalist design, refining the exterior to create a timeless and captivating look.

Streamlined Front Fascia: The front fascia of the Model 3 has been updated with a more streamlined appearance. The iconic grille-less face remains, but subtle changes enhance its overall aesthetics. The sleek lines and smooth surfaces contribute to improved aerodynamics, helping to reduce drag and increase efficiency.

Sleeker Wheels: The new Model 3 offers a choice of updated wheel designs, all optimized for better aerodynamic performance. These wheels not only look fantastic but also help increase the vehicle's overall range.

Refined Lighting: Tesla has equipped the Model 3 with advanced LED lighting technology. Sleeker, more efficient headlights not only enhance visibility but also contribute to the car's overall aerodynamic efficiency.

Interior Refinements: Enhanced Comfort and Technology

Interior Refinements: Enhanced Comfort and Technology

Tesla has also made significant strides in upgrading the interior of the Model 3, elevating both comfort and technology to new heights.

Reimagined Dashboard: The most noticeable change inside the Model 3 is the reimagined dashboard. Tesla has opted for a minimalist and uncluttered design with a horizontally oriented center screen. This new setup provides a clean and elegant look while maintaining access to all the vehicle's features.

Enhanced Connectivity: The infotainment system has received a boost in connectivity, ensuring that drivers and passengers stay connected and entertained on the road. Improved navigation, music streaming, and over-the-air updates are just a few examples of the Model 3's upgraded capabilities.

Premium Materials: Tesla continues to prioritize premium materials throughout the interior. The Model 3 offers an inviting and high-quality cabin environment that sets it apart from traditional gasoline-powered vehicles.

Porsche plans a trio of powertrains for the Cayenne into the next decade

For more than 20 years, the Cayenne has been characterised by its ability to provide the broad range of qualities between characteristic Porsche driving performance, excellent comfort in everyday driving, and great capability when driving off-road. The future models of the SUV will seamlessly continue this success story, retaining all of the car’s familiar features.

“The Cayenne has always defined the sports car in its segment. In the middle of the decade, the fourth generation will set standards in the segment as an electric SUV,” said Blume, CEO of Porsche AG. At the same time, into the next decade our customers will still be able to choose from a wide range of powerful and efficient combustion and hybrid models.

"The third generation of the Cayenne will be further upgraded and will continue to be offered alongside the fourth, all-electric generation".

The current Cayenne generation, which last year was given one of the most extensive product upgrades in the history of Porsche, will be further developed with major technological investment in the future. Here the developers will be focusing, among other things, on the powertrains, in particular on improving the efficiency of the V8 developed by Porsche and built at the Zuffenhausen engine plant. Extensive technical measures will ensure that the twin-turbo engine is ready to comply with future legislative requirements.

The Corporate Engine Powering VinFast's Global Push

In a bold move against the prevailing headwinds in the electric vehicle (EV) industry, VinFast, the young Vietnamese EV manufacturer, is forging ahead with its ambitious global expansion plans. While major players like Apple have recently abandoned their decade-long pursuit of an electric vehicle, and others are scaling back their ambitions, VinFast remains undeterred. Having already established a presence in the U.S., Canada, and Southeast Asia, the company is now setting its sights on the Middle Eastern market.
